Ordinals
beta
Address 1FqbcRXX5fs86MSLAjML6T3C7uKstvYEbA
sat balance
1000067
outputs
d3c5a947ef3d6b09a554b98667eb5a8c459c878ff842ea0f42db8add32582d8a:1